The Asama Volcano Museum (浅間火山博物館, Asama-kazan Hakubutsukan), close to the active complex volcano Mount Asama in Japan, is a museum that explains volcanoes.

The museum is in Naganohara-machi, Agatsuma-gun, Gunma Prefecture. As of early 2009, it was open from April until November.
